The Breed's Connection: Joseph Warren & Byron Parker
General Joseph Warren was killed by a British officer atop Breed's Hill at the Battle of Bunker Hill. Almost 100 years later, one of Hudson's most prominent businessmen, Byron Parker, began his plumbing business at 436 Warren St. Parker's mother was a member of the Breed family who owned the land where the Battle of Bunker Hill was fought.
